Recipe Timing

  • Prep Duration: 15 minutes
  • Active Cooking: 12 minutes
  • Total Duration: 27 minutes
  • Portion Size: Serves 2
  • Complexity: Simple

Ingredients:

  • 2 boneless sk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 tablespoons barbecue sauce
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 cups mixed salad greens
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1/2 cup thinly sliced red onion
  • 1 ripe avocado
  • 2 tablespoons Greek yogurt
  • 2 tablespoons lime juice
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ons chopped cilantro
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 2 tablespoons water

Method:

Step 1: Season the Chicken

In a bowl, season the chicken breasts with smoked paprika, chili powder, salt, and black pepper. Brush both sides generously with barbecue sauce to infuse flavor right into the meat.

Step 2: Heat the Cooking Surface

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ium heat or on a preheated grill pan, allowing it to get nice and hot. This step is crucial for achieving a beautiful sear on the chicken.

Step 3: Sauté the Chicken

Cook the chicken for 5–6 minutes per side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F. This ensures your chicken is fully cooked and juicy.

Step 4: Let It Rest

Remove the chicken from heat and let it rest for 5 minutes. Resting allows the juices to redistribute, keeping your chicken tender and flavorful when sliced.

Step 5: Blend the Creamy Avocado Dressing

In a blender, combine the ripe avocado, Greek yogurt, lime juice, minced garlic, cilantro, ground cumin, and water. Blend until smooth, adding a pinch of salt and pepper to taste. The rich green hue of this dressing is as inviting as its flavor!

Step 6: Prepare the Salad Base

In a large bowl, toss together the mixed salad greens, cherry tomatoes, and red onion. The colors are vibrant, and the crunch of the veggies promises a refreshing bite!

Step 7: Assemble the Salad

Arrange the sliced chicken breast on top of the salad mixture. This layer brings the heartiness of the chicken straight to your greens.

Step 8: Drizzle and Enjoy

Finally, drizzle the creamy avocado dressing generously over the salad and serve it immediately. Each bowl will be a colorful feast, eagerly awaiting to be enjoyed!

Storage & Leftovers Guide

If you find yourself with leftovers (though they’re hard to resist!), store the salad and dressing separately in airtight containers. The salad mixture can last for up to 2 days in the fridge, while the dressing will stay fresh for about 3 days. Just be sure to give the dressing a good shake before using it again!

Kitchen Wisdom & Success Tips

  • Cook chicken evenly: Make sure your skillet or grill pan is hot enough before adding the chicken; this helps achieve a nice sear.
  • Adjust flavors: Feel free to tweak the spices and BBQ sauce to match your taste preference. A touch of honey can balance the spice if you prefer a sweeter profile.

Flavor Variations & Adaptations

Mix it up! Try adding sliced bell peppers, cucumbers, or even black beans for extra texture and flavor. If you’re in a hurry, rotisserie chicken makes a fantastic substitute for the grilled chicken.

Reader Questions & Solutions

  • Q: Can I use frozen chicken breasts?
    • A: Yes, but make sure to fully thaw them before cooking for even cooking and best texture.
  • Q: What can I substitute for Greek yogurt?
    • A: Sour cream or any non-dairy yogurt works well as a substitute!
  • Q: How can I make it spicier?
    • A: Add a pinch of cayenne pepper to the seasoning mix or a dash of hot sauce to the dressing!
  • Q: What if I don’t have avocados?
    • A: You can create a zesty dressing by substituting with a vinaigrette made from olive oil, vinegar, and a hint of mustard.
  • Q: Can I make this salad ahead of time?
    • A: Assembling the salad in advance is fine, just add the dressing right before serving to keep the greens crisp!
